China to Impose Environment Tax during 12th Five-Year Plan

[2010-11-29 12:27:04]


Xie Zhenhua, a deputy director of the National Development and Reform Commission, indicated at a press conference on Nov. 23 that related authorities are actively studying the possibility of imposing a environmental protection tax during the 12th Five-Year Plan.

Xie also revealed that the related department is still studying carbon tax policy. But China will use market mechanisms and economic instruments to achieve the goal of reducing carbon dioxide emissions intensity during the 12th Five-Year Plan, Xie said. Currently, China has explored carbon trading pilots in major cities, including Tianjin, Beijing and Shanghai.
